Bishwa Ijtema begins

Sun News Desk: The first phase of three-day Biswa Ijtema, the second largest congregation of Muslims after Hajj, began on the bank of Turag River in Gazipur's Tongi on Friday.

The congregation started with the a'mbayan (general sermons) of Maulana Ziaul Haque after Fajr prayers.

In the afternoon, Jummah prayers, the biggest in memory, were held at the Ijtema ground. Maulana Zobair, leader of a section of Tabligh Jamaat, led the prayers.

However, the first phase of Bishwa Ijtema will end on January 15 while the second phase will be held on January 20-22.

Noted that Tabligh Jamaat has been organising the congregation at the venue since 1967.

In 2011, it divided Ijtema into two phases to accommodate a large number of attendees.

The second phase of Ijtema will be held from January 20 to 22 this year.
